The Science Behind the Float
To understand this phenomenon, we must explore the principles of buoyancy. Buoyancy is the upward force exerted by a fluid (in this case, water) on an object immersed in it. This force opposes the weight of the object, allowing it to float. So, could this house be buoyant enough to float on the river's surface?
The Missing Piece: The River's Depth
And this is the part most people miss: the depth of the river. If the river is deep enough, the house's foundation might not touch the bottom, allowing it to float freely. However, if the river is shallow, the house's bottom could indeed drag along the riverbed, creating an unusual sight.
